Doctoral Researcher in Microelectronics and IC Design (Ultra-Low-Power SoCs)

Tampere University invites applications for a Doctoral Researcher position in Microelectronics and Integrated Circuit (IC) Design, focusing on ultra-low-power SoCs and advanced adaptive clock and power management architectures. The position is based in the Integrated Power & Sensing Systems (IPSS) Lab within the Electrical Engineering Unit at the Faculty of Information and Communication Sciences. The lab specializes in energy-efficient ICs and system solutions for next-generation edge and bio-integrated applications, emphasizing co-design of sensing interfaces, adaptive power delivery, and mixed-signal integrated systems. The research will center on developing advanced adaptive voltage and frequency scaling techniques to enhance energy efficiency and robustness under process, voltage, and temperature (PVT) variations and extreme workload fluctuations. Key responsibilities include designing and implementing circuit and architecture-level solutions for critical-path monitoring, clock generation, and power regulation in advanced CMOS technologies. The role also involves modeling, simulation, and experimental validation of timing, power, and performance trade-offs, as well as disseminating research findings through scientific publications, reports, and conference presentations. Collaboration with colleagues across Tampere University and external project partners is integral to the position. Applicants must hold a master’s degree in electrical engineering, computer engineering, or a related field prior to the start date. Essential skills include IC design, tape-out, experimental validation, PCB board design, and strong English language proficiency. Candidates should demonstrate the ability to conduct systematic scientific research, problem-solving skills, and effective communication in multidisciplinary and international environments. If the degree was not completed in Finland, an official English certificate is required. The successful candidate must apply for and be granted a study right for a doctoral degree at Tampere University. The position is offered for a fixed-term period of up to four years, starting in September 2026, with a six-month trial period.
